Applying graph theory to improve the quality of scientific evidence from textual information: Neural injuries after gynaecologic pelvic surgery for genital prolapse and urinary incontinence

Abstract: To provide the overall rate for all types of neurologic iatrogenic injuries during urogynaecologic surgery from textual data. Methods: Systematic research focused on complications of gynaecologic surgery and neurologic injuries in abstracts. Keywords concerning complications (cluster A), unspecific; neurologic issues (cluster B); surgery (generic words) (cluster C); specific gynaecologic operations (cluster D); and specific gynaecologic operations for pelvic organ prolapse and urinary incontinence (cluster E) … Show more
